Lagos – A Federal High Court in Lagos, on Wednesday, adjourned a case of alleged drug trafficking to Nov. 7, to enable the 33-year old suspect Saheed Azeez, take his plea.

The National Drug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A), had arraigned Azeez on one-count charge of drug trafficking, for allegedly peddling 2.8 kg of Cannabis Sativa, known as Marijuana.

The criminal charge marked FHC/L/350C/2019, is pending before Justice Maureen Onyetenu.

According to the charge singed by NDLEA prosecutor, Mr Jeremiah Aernan, the defendant was alleged to have committed the offence on Sept. 1.

Aernan alleged that the defendant was unlawfully engaged in the sale and distribution of Cannabis Sativa within the Aburo, Iyana-Ipaja area of Lagos.

The prosecutor said Cannabis was a banned narcotic substance, and trafficking in same contravened the provisions of Section 11(c) of the NDLEA Act, Cap N30 Laws of the Federation, 2004.

The Act provides for life imprisonment for a convicted offender.
